在当今数据驱动的商业环境中,数据分析已成为企业决策和创新的关键。随着技术的不断进步,市场上出现了许多功能强大且用户友好的数据分析软件,它们可以帮助企业从海量数据中提取有价值的信息,支持业务决策和战略规划。以下是一些受欢迎的数据分析软件:
1. Excel
- 功能丰富:Excel是最常用的电子表格软件之一,它提供了强大的数据处理和分析能力。用户可以创建复杂的数据集,进行各种统计分析,并生成图表和报告。Excel还支持宏编程,使得自动化任务变得简单。
- 易用性高:Excel的用户界面直观,学习曲线平缓,即使是没有太多计算机背景的人也能快速上手。它的拖放功能和公式编辑器使得数据处理更加高效。
- 兼容性好:Excel可以与Microsoft Office套件中的其他组件无缝集成,如Word、PowerPoint等,方便用户在不同应用程序之间共享数据和结果。
2. SPSS
- 统计分析工具:SPSS是一款专业的统计软件,提供了一系列统计分析工具,包括描述性统计、推断统计、相关性分析、回归分析等。它还支持因子分析、聚类分析和主成分分析等高级统计方法。
- 数据管理功能:SPSS具有强大的数据管理和处理功能,可以导入多种数据格式,如CSV、XLS、TXT等。它还支持数据的清洗、转换和合并操作,确保数据的准确性和完整性。
- 可视化工具:SPSS提供了丰富的可视化工具,可以将复杂的统计结果以图形的方式展示出来,帮助用户更好地理解数据。它还支持多种图表类型,如柱状图、折线图、饼图等,满足不同的展示需求。
3. Stata
- 统计分析能力:Stata是一款强大的统计软件,提供了一系列统计分析方法和工具,包括线性回归、方差分析、协方差分析、路径分析等。它还支持时间序列分析、生存分析等特殊领域的统计方法。
- 数据管理功能:Stata具有强大的数据管理和处理功能,可以导入多种数据格式,如CSV、TXT、DBF等。它还支持数据的清洗、转换和合并操作,确保数据的准确性和完整性。
- 可视化工具:Stata提供了丰富的可视化工具,可以将复杂的统计结果以图形的方式展示出来,帮助用户更好地理解数据。它还支持多种图表类型,如条形图、散点图、箱线图等,满足不同的展示需求。
4. R语言
- 统计分析能力:R语言是一种通用编程语言,特别适合进行统计分析和图形绘制。它提供了丰富的统计包和函数库,如dplyr、tidyr、ggplot2等,使得数据处理和分析更加便捷。R语言还支持自定义函数和脚本,可以根据具体需求进行扩展。
- 数据科学能力:R语言在数据科学领域具有广泛的应用,特别是在机器学习和深度学习方面。它提供了大量用于构建和训练模型的包和资源,如caret、mlr、keras等。R语言还支持多种数据结构和算法,可以进行高效的数据处理和分析。
- 可视化工具:R语言提供了强大的可视化工具,可以将复杂的统计结果以图形的方式展示出来,帮助用户更好地理解数据。它支持多种图表类型,如散点图、直方图、箱线图等,满足不同的展示需求。R语言还支持交互式绘图和动态数据可视化,使得数据分析更加生动有趣。
5. Tableau
- 数据可视化:Tableau是一款数据可视化工具,可以将复杂的数据转换为直观的图表和仪表板。它支持多种图表类型,如柱状图、折线图、饼图等,满足不同的展示需求。Tableau还提供了丰富的主题和样式,可以定制个性化的图表。
- 易于使用:Tableau的用户界面简洁明了,无需编程知识即可创建复杂的数据可视化。它还支持拖放操作,使得数据可视化过程更加灵活和高效。Tableau还提供了丰富的模板和示例,可以快速上手并制作出专业级别的数据可视化。
- 数据连接:Tableau支持与其他数据源的连接,如SQL数据库、API等。这使得用户可以将外部数据整合到数据可视化中,丰富数据来源和视角。Tableau还支持数据更新和刷新,可以实时展示最新的数据变化。
6. Power BI
- 数据连接:Power BI是一款商业智能工具,可以将来自不同数据源的数据整合在一起,形成统一的视图。它支持多种数据源的连接,如Excel、SQL数据库、API等。Power BI还提供了数据刷新和更新功能,可以实时展示最新的数据变化。
- 数据挖掘:Power BI提供了丰富的数据挖掘和分析功能,可以对数据进行深入的挖掘和分析。它支持多种分析模型和方法,如预测建模、分类分析、聚类分析等。Power BI还提供了可视化工具,可以将复杂的分析结果以图形的方式展示出来,帮助用户更好地理解数据。
- 移动应用:Power BI提供了移动应用版本,可以在智能手机或平板电脑上进行数据分析和可视化。这使得用户可以随时随地访问和管理数据,提高工作效率和灵活性。
7. QlikView
- 数据探索:QlikView是一款数据探索工具,可以快速地发现数据中的趋势、模式和异常。它提供了多种数据探索功能,如趋势线、散点图、热力图等。QlikView还支持交互式查询和筛选,使得数据探索过程更加灵活和高效。
- 数据可视化:QlikView提供了丰富的可视化选项,可以将复杂的数据以图形的方式展示出来。它支持多种图表类型,如柱状图、折线图、饼图等,满足不同的展示需求。QlikView还提供了交互式图表和仪表板,可以动态地展示数据和分析结果。
- 定制化:QlikView允许用户根据需要定制数据视图和报表。它提供了丰富的主题和样式选项,可以定制个性化的报表和仪表板。QlikView还支持自定义查询和表达式,使得数据分析更加灵活和强大。
8. Google Data Studio
- 数据探索:Google Data Studio是一个在线平台,用于探索、分析和分享数据。它提供了多种数据探索功能,如趋势线、散点图、热力图等。Google Data Studio还支持交互式查询和筛选,使得数据探索过程更加灵活和高效。
- 数据可视化:Google Data Studio提供了丰富的可视化选项,可以将复杂的数据以图形的方式展示出来。它支持多种图表类型,如柱状图、折线图、饼图等,满足不同的展示需求。Google Data Studio还提供了交互式图表和仪表板,可以动态地展示数据和分析结果。
- 定制化:Google Data Studio允许用户根据需要定制数据视图和报表。它提供了丰富的主题和样式选项,可以定制个性化的报表和仪表板。Google Data Studio还支持自定义查询和表达式,使得数据分析更加灵活和强大。
9. Looker
- 数据探索:Looker是一个现代化的数据探索平台,它提供了一个直观的界面来探索和分析数据。Looker支持多种数据探索功能,如趋势线、散点图、热力图等。Looker还支持交互式查询和筛选,使得数据探索过程更加灵活和高效。
- 数据可视化:Looker提供了丰富的可视化选项,可以将复杂的数据以图形的方式展示出来。它支持多种图表类型,如柱状图、折线图、饼图等,满足不同的展示需求。Looker还提供了交互式图表和仪表板,可以动态地展示数据和分析结果。
- 定制化:Looker允许用户根据需要定制数据视图和报表。它提供了丰富的主题和样式选项,可以定制个性化的报表和仪表板。Looker还支持自定义查询和表达式,使得数据分析更加灵活和强大。
10. Apache Nifi
- 数据采集:Apache Nifi是一个开源的数据流处理框架,它可以用于数据采集、转换和路由。它支持多种数据源的连接,如数据库、文件系统、API等。Nifi还提供了数据转换和路由的功能,可以将数据从一种格式转换到另一种格式,或者将数据路由到不同的目的地。
- 数据处理:Apache Nifi提供了丰富的数据处理功能,可以对数据进行清洗、转换和聚合等操作。它支持多种数据处理流程,如日志处理、批处理、流处理等。Nifi还提供了可视化工具,可以直观地查看数据处理的过程和结果。
- 数据存储:Apache Nifi支持将处理后的数据存储到多种数据存储系统中,如关系型数据库、NoSQL数据库、文件系统等。它提供了数据导出功能,可以将处理后的数据导出为多种格式的文件。Nifi还支持数据的持久化和备份,确保数据的可靠性和安全性。
综上所述,这些工具各有特点,适用于不同的场景和需求。在选择时,应考虑数据量、数据处理复杂度、团队技能水平以及预算等因素。同时,建议先进行小规模的试点测试,以便找到最适合自己团队的工具。